Easy Christmas Chocolate Pretzel Toffee Recipe

If you love sweet treats then this Easy Christmas Chocolate Pretzel Toffee Recipe is the perfect addition to your holiday cookie platter. It covers all bases. Sweet, salty, crunchy and highly craveable! The best part is that this toffee pretzel recipe takes only minutes to make and does not require a candy thermometer!

Equipment

  • saucepan
  • baking pan
  • aluminum foil
  • cooking spray
  • whisk or spatula

Ingredients

  • 2 cups pretzels (enough to cover a baking tray)
  • ½ cup unsalted butter
  • ½ cup brown sugar
  • 1 cup semi-sweet chocolate chips
  • sprinkles, optional
  • ¼ cup white chocolate, optional

Instructions

  • Preheat oven to 350° F. Cover a rimmed baking tray with foil. Spray with cooking spray. (The cooking spray is very important so the pretzels do not stick.
  • Cover your baking tray with an even layer of pretzels getting them as close together as possible.
  • In a small sauce pan over medium heat melt the butter and stir in the brown sugar.
  • Once the mixture comes to a boil time for 3 minutes. Stir occasionally to make sure this does not stick.
  • When the 3 minutes has passed, carefully pour the mixture over the pretzels. The trick is to get enough on so that they stick together. It will not completely cover and that is okay.
  • Place the pretzels in the preheated oven for 5-6 minutes. Remove from the oven and sprinkle with semi-sweet chocolate chips. (Reserving the white chocolate)
  • Use a spatula to spread the chocolate over the mixture. You may see a pretzel peaking out but that is okay, just cover as much as possible.
  • Add the sprinkles to the chocolate while it is still melted so that it will adhere.
  • Melt the white chocolate in the microwave in 30 second intervals and stir between each until the chocolate is smooth. Add a ½ teaspoon vegetable oil to make it easier to drizzle if necessary.
  • Drizzle the white chocolate over the top of the pretzel toffee. Cool for 20 minutes and then place in the refrigerator for an hour to completely harden.
  • Once the chocolate has harden carefully peel away from foil. Place on a cutting board and cut into piece or break into pieces.
  • Store in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 2 weeks.
